Bizarre 'magnet shark' sticks onto ship's wall
This is the bizarre moment a shark stuck to a ship's wall like a magnet.
Crew member Treblig Sibon recorded the deep sea marine creature seemingly attaching itself to the wall of their ship in Dampier, Australia on March 15.
Sibon's colleague appeared to have trouble removing the creature, which had adhered itself firmly on the flat surface.
The maintenance worker said that the shark was caught from the sea and was supposed to be the staff meal, but the crew ended up releasing it later on because they were afraid of its seemingly magnetic properties.
He said: 'It looked dangerous so we decided to take it back to the ocean. It's the first time we've seen that kind of creature, so it's better to be careful.'
